Book computer science engineering

The best books on computer science and programming five. Best books for every computer engineer l subject wise book list. The course is now an elective that the majority of our electrical and computer engineering students take in the second semester of their freshman year, just before their first circuits course. Top 10 mustread books for computer science majors computer. It is a huge field overlapping pure mathematics, engineering and many other scientific disciplines. These books are used by computer science students of top universities in the world such as mit massachusetts, ucb berkeley, carnegie mellon, harvard. Delftse foundations of computation is a textbook for a one quarter introductory course in theoretical computer science. The concentration in computer science is designed to teach students skills they will use immediately and ideas they will exploit in the future in ways unimaginable today. This section provides courseware and readings for each session of the course, and the full course textbook. Additionaly, computer engineering combines electrical engineering and science, with a focus on softwarehardware interactions. Bs in computer science university of virginia school of. Given that so much of software engineering is on web servers and clients, one of the most immediately valuable areas of computer science is computer networking.

The best books on programming and computer science, as recommended by ana bell, lecturer in the electrical engineering and computer science department at the massachusetts institute of technology. Plain language, plenty of additional tips, and annotated code make it a really good first computer science book. As with any area of study, computer science has a history, various processes, and enough differing opinions to fill a library. Physical sciences, engineering and technology chemistry 161 computer and information science 410 earth and planetary sciences 160 engineering 797 materials science 256 mathematics 49 nanotechnology and nanomaterials 99 physics 124 robotics 95 technology 97 more. When combined with educational content written by respected scholars across the curriculum, mastering engineering and mastering computer science help deliver the learning outcomes that students and instructors. Computer science, bachelor of engineering in computer. The books cover theory of computation, algorithms, data structures, artificial intelligence, databases, information retrieval, coding theory, information science, programming language theory, cryptography. Basic engineering series and tools consists of modularized texts designed to give beginning engineering students an orientation to the profession of engineering and to teach them certain skills and tools they will need in their other course work. Data science major computer science and engineering at. Mit electrical engineering and computer science mit press. Lessons in electric circuits 6 volumes, the last one published in january 2004, for students in electrical engineering. Computer engineers usually have training in electronic engineering or electrical engineering, software design, and hardwaresoftware integration instead of only software engineering or electronic engineering. Universal algebra for computer science all the algebra computer scientists will need. This free book provides a further insight in this direction.

Computer engineering ce is a branch of engineering that integrates several fields of computer science and electronic engineering required to develop computer hardware and software. Computer science is the study of processes that interact with data and that can be represented as data in the form of programs. It is the systematic study of the feasibility, structure, expression, and mechanization of the methodical procedures or algorithms that underlie the acquisition, representation, processing, storage, communication of, and access to information, whether such information is encoded as bits in a. Oct 24, 2017 additionaly, computer engineering combines electrical engineering and science, with a focus on softwarehardware interactions. Computer science is one of the disciplines of modern science under which, we study about the various aspects of computer technologies, their development, and their applications in the present world. In this video i summarise as much of the subject as i. Computer science engineering courses, subjects, eligibility. Basics of computer science tutorial tutorialspoint. The best books on programming and computer science, as recommended by ana bell, lecturer in the electrical engineering and computer science. This series is no longer active, and the mit press is no longer accepting proposals for books in the series. The course includes hardware and software aspects of both computer design and computer applications. The books cover theory of computation, algorithms, data structures, artificial intelligence, databases, information retrieval, coding theory, information science. Our free computer science, programming and it books will keep you up to date on programming and core issues within computer and information technology. Engineering books pdf, download free books related to engineering and many more.

Computer engineers usually have training in electronic engineering or electrical engineering, software design, and hardwaresoftware integration instead of. Free computer science books list of freely available cs textbooks, papers, lecture notes, and other documents. The garland science website is no longer available to access and you have been automatically redirected to. Every subject has its required reading, and computer science is no different.

Free computer books download online computer ebooks. Computer science engineering cse encompasses a variety of topics that relates to computation, like analysis of algorithms, programming languages, program design, software, and computer hardware. Which include core computer science, networking, programming languages, systems programming books, linux books and many more. Computer science ii semester lecture notes download. Buy products related to computer science and engineering books and see what customers say about computer science and engineering books on.

As creators of information technologies our graduates are reaching out to people and the world by supporting and enhancing communication, health care, entertainment, scientific inquiry, transportation, business, and almost any other endeavor you can imagine. Computer science engineering has roots in electrical engineering, mathematics, and linguistics. Find the top 100 most popular items in amazon books best sellers. Topics include markov chains, detection, coding, estimation, viterbi. Our selftaught students who methodically study networking find that they finally understand terms, concepts and protocols theyd been surrounded by. Likewise, computer science includes a wide range of topics such as the development of computer. Aug 09, 2019 for a real, stepbystep concept computer science book, try greg perrys and dean millers c programming absolute beginners guide 3rd edition. For a real, stepbystep concept computer science book, try greg perrys and dean millers c programming absolute beginners guide 3rd edition. It provides innovative ideas in the field of computer science and engineering with a view to face new. Even though students may be registered officially for a course, the electrical engineering and computer science department may give away a students place in a class if they do not attend the first week of lectures and labsdiscussions as appropriate for any eecs courses. A computer scientist studies the theory of computation and the design of software systems its fields can be divided into theoretical and practical disciplines. Eecs home electrical engineering and computer science. Software engineering vs computer science field engineer. The book consists of over 100 chapters covering material across nearly major area of computer science.

A double major between data science and computer science, or between data science and statistics, is permitted. Engineering the computer science and it free computer books. Computer engineering and computer science can mean different things to different people. Computer science engineering free ebooks, download free computer science textbooks, books, lecture notes and presentations covering subjectwise full semester syllabus. Thank you for visiting the engineering and computer science web pages at colorado technical university ctu. A first course in electrical and computer engineering open. The book is designed for a juniorsenior level course.

Each features a firm grounding in fundamentals of mathematics, basic science, and computer and engineering science, and advanced studies in the theory and design of systems of various kinds. Get detailed info on computer engineering specializations, career. This has created a lot of job vacancies for computer science engineering students too. Computer science harvard college handbook for students.

This book was written for an experimental freshman course at the university of colorado. This site lists free online computer science, engineering and programming books, textbooks and lecture notes, all of which are legally and freely available. The books in this series are written by the faculty of the electrical engineering and computer science department at the massachusetts institute of technology. Pagerank, multiplexing, digital link, tracking, speech recognition, route planning and more.

Engineering books pdf download free engineering books. Ana bell is a lecturer in the electrical engineering and computer science department at mit for introduction to computer science and programming using python, introduction to computational thinking and data science, and an instructor for the same courses on. Computer science is the scientific and practical approach to computation and its applications. Software engineering l graphical design and image processing l world wide web new search techniques l communication protocols how can we compress data into smaller sizes l compilers is it possible to take advantage of new chipsachitectures. It enables the use of algorithms to manipulate, store, and communicate digital information. I think this article may be explaining the american view. Best reference books computer science and engineering. Readings mathematics for computer science electrical. Full of great anecdotes, plus theory about how users form models in their heads and how users make errors.

For this list, weve found the top 10 mustread books for computer science majors. The course deals with the design, construction, operation, and maintenance of computing hardware and software. Computer science iii semester lecture notes download. Electrical engineering electronics engineering mechanical engineering computer engineering chemistry questions. A first course in electrical and computer engineering. By jianqun lin, ling gao, huibin lin, yilin ren, yutian lin and jianqiang lin.

The department offers three bachelor of science degrees. It is critical that students attend classes from the beginning of the term. File type pdf books computer engineering books computer engineering top 5 books for computer engineering students what ive used and recommend in this video i share the top 5 books that have helped me the most and have used frequently in my undergraduate computer. Database of free online computer science and programming. Computer science engineering lecture notes all semesterfree download semester free download. In this video i summarise as much of the subject as i can and show how the areas are related to.

Computer science i semester lecture notes download. She received her phd in computational biology from princeton university in. This little book is a classic work on usability, not just of computer interfaces but also of physical objects like doors, showers, and stoves. Discover the best computer science in best sellers. Computer science engineering lecture notes all semester. Sep 06, 2017 it is a huge field overlapping pure mathematics, engineering and many other scientific disciplines. Correspondingly, the computer science concentration has strong ties not just to engineering, but also economics, law, biology, physics, statistics, mathematics, and more. To pursue a dual degree with another academic unit, see the college of engineering rules on combined degree programs see section on multiple dependent degree programs. Mit electrical engineering and computer science syllabus. Download free computer engineering pdf books and training materials. Scroll down for complete downloads of all the books in a single tar.

Computer science engineering ebooks download computer. Our department decided to offer this course for several reasons. Mathematics for computer science, is available for. Graph theory with applications to engineering and computer science by narsingh. Our selftaught students who methodically study networking find that they finally understand terms, concepts and protocols theyd been surrounded by for years. Which include core computer science, networking, programming languages. It includes topics from propositional and predicate logic, proof techniques, set theory and the theory of computation, along with practical applications to computer science. In spain, the degree, at the time i did it, was called computer science engineering, literally translated, and it lasted for 5 years.

Computer science pdf computer science engineering syllabus. Mastering engineering and mastering computer science are the teaching and learning platforms that empower you to reach every student. Which is the best book for computer science engineering. Some of the most common programs offered in computer engineering include processor interfacing, digital logical design, thermodynamics, power management, solid state physics, and magnetic fields. This ebook collection of computer science engineering includes from the first semester to the eight semesters of computer science engineering of all the universities. Computer science or bachelor of engineering in computer science is an undergraduate computer engineering course. Computer science engineering books free pdf download from popular publishers schand, phi, ik, laxmi, sanguine, teri press, khanna. In particular, i would like to extend a warm welcome to prospective engineering and computer science students, parents, and others who have shown an interest in our programs.

1487 977 146 90 1564 1386 766 494 703 937 1030 958 1527 1341 543 381 1160 976 416 1289 642 1110 1342 1184 745 69 858 928 976 28